TimelineSpan - 전역
이 클래스는 TimelineItem 내에서 렌더링된 요소의 특성 및 대화형 동작을 설명하는 속성 집합을 정의합니다.
TimelineItem의 모든 범위 컬렉션이 고유해야 하는 것이 매우 중요하므로 기존 TimelineItem 인스턴스의createTimelineItem 메서드를 통해 새 인스턴스를 만들어야 합니다.
TimelineSpan - addPredecessor(객체 배열, objArray)
JavaScript 개체의 배열을 열거하여 현재 인스턴스와 다른 TimelineSpan 개체 간의 여러 관계를 추가합니다.
각 개체에는 _id 및 predecessor_sys_id 지정된 내부 속성이 relationship_sys있어야 합니다.
| 이름 | 유형 | 설명 |
|---|---|---|
| obj배열 | 객체 배열 | 두 개의 내부 속성을 포함하는 JavaScript 객체 배열입니다 relationship_sys_idpredecessor_sys_id. |
| 유형 | 설명 |
|---|---|
| void |
TimelineSpan - addPredecessor(String strPredecessorSysId, String strRelationshipSysId, String strTableName)
현재 인스턴스와 다른 TimelineSpan 사이에 지정된 관계를 추가하고 관계가 GlideWindow 를 열어 관계에 대한 정보를 표시할 수 있도록 합니다.
| 이름 | 유형 | 설명 |
|---|---|---|
| strPredecessorSysId | 문자열 | 관계의 선행 작업인 계획된 작업의 시스템 ID입니다. |
| strRelationshipSysId | 문자열 | 관계 관계의 시스템 ID입니다. |
| strTable이름 | 문자열 | 관계에 대한 테이블의 이름입니다. |
| 유형 | 설명 |
|---|---|
| void |
TimelineSpan - addPredecessor(String strPredecessorSysId, String strRelationshipSysId)
현재 인스턴스와 sys IDstrPredecessorSysId가 있는 다른 TimelineSpan 사이에 지정된 관계를 추가합니다.
그려진 선에는 연결된 두 번 클릭 처리기가 없습니다.
| 이름 | 유형 | 설명 |
|---|---|---|
| strPredecessorSysId | 문자열 | 관계의 선행 작업인 계획된 작업의 시스템 ID입니다. |
| strRelationshipSysId | 문자열 | 관계 관계의 시스템 ID입니다. |
| 유형 | 설명 |
|---|---|
| void |
타임라인 범위 - getAllowXDragLeft()
속성의 부울 값을 AllowXDragLeft 반환합니다.
| 이름 | 유형 | 설명 |
|---|---|---|
| 없음 |
| 유형 | 설명 |
|---|---|
| 부울 | 개체의 시작 시간을 조정할 수 있으면 true입니다. 그렇지 않으면 False입니다. |
타임라인스팬 - getAllowXDragRight()
속성의 부울 값을 AllowXDragRight 반환합니다.
| 이름 | 유형 | 설명 |
|---|---|---|
| 없음 |
| 유형 | 설명 |
|---|---|
| 부울 | 개체의 종료 시간을 조정할 수 있으면 true 입니다. 그렇지 않으면 false 입니다. |
TimelineSpan - getAllowXMove()
속성의 부울 값을 AllowXMove 반환합니다.
| 이름 | 유형 | 설명 |
|---|---|---|
| 없음 |
| 유형 | 설명 |
|---|---|
| 부울 | 개체를 이동할 수 있으면 True 입니다. 그렇지 않으면 false 입니다. |
타임라인스팬 - getAllowYMove()
속성의 부울 값을 AllowYMove 반환합니다.
| 이름 | 유형 | 설명 |
|---|---|---|
| 없음 |
| 유형 | 설명 |
|---|---|
| 부울 | 개체를 세로로 이동할 수 있으면 True 입니다. 그렇지 않으면 false 입니다. |
타임라인범위 - getAllowYMovePredecessor()
속성의 부울 값을 AllowYMovePredecessor 반환합니다.
| 이름 | 유형 | 설명 |
|---|---|---|
| 없음 |
| 유형 | 설명 |
|---|---|
| 부울 | 현재 개체에서 새 후속 항목으로 파선 관계 선을 그릴 수 있으면 True 입니다. 그렇지 않으면 false 입니다. |
타임라인 범위 - getInnerSegmentClass()
TimelineSpan에 대한 현재 내부 세그먼트 클래스의 이름을 반환합니다.
| 이름 | 유형 | 설명 |
|---|---|---|
| 없음 |
| 유형 | 설명 |
|---|---|
| 문자열 | 현재 내부 세그먼트 스타일의 클래스 이름입니다. |
TimelineSpan - getInnerSegmentEndTimeMs()
TimelineSpan의 내부 세그먼트 부분에 대한 종료 시간의 시간(밀리초)을 반환합니다.
| 이름 | 유형 | 설명 |
|---|---|---|
| 없음 |
| 유형 | 설명 |
|---|---|
| 번호 | TimelineSpan 내부 세그먼트 부분의 종료 시간(밀리초)입니다. |
타임라인스팬 - getInnerSegmentStartTimeMs()
TimelineSpan의 내부 세그먼트 부분에 대한 시작 시간의 시간(밀리초)을 반환합니다.
| 이름 | 유형 | 설명 |
|---|---|---|
| 없음 |
| 유형 | 설명 |
|---|---|
| 번호 | TimelineSpan 내부 세그먼트 부분의 시작 시간(밀리초)입니다. |
타임라인스팬 - getIsChanged()
초기화 후 현재 타임라인 항목이 수정되었는지 여부를 지정하는 부울을 반환합니다.
| 이름 | 유형 | 설명 |
|---|---|---|
| 없음 |
| 유형 | 설명 |
|---|---|
| 부울 | 현재 범위가 변경된 것으로 표시되어 있으면 true 이고, 그렇지 않으면 false입니다. |
타임라인스팬 - getPointIconClass()
현재 인스턴스에 기간이 0인 경우 타임라인에 요소를 표시하는 데 사용할 아이콘 클래스의 이름을 지정하는 문자열을 반환합니다.
| 이름 | 유형 | 설명 |
|---|---|---|
| 없음 |
| 유형 | 설명 |
|---|---|
| 문자열 | 기간이 0인 경우 현재 TimelineSpan 을 표시하는 데 사용할 아이콘 클래스의 이름입니다. |
타임라인스팬 - getPredecessors()
현재 인스턴스와 연결된 모든 선행 객체의 배열을 반환합니다. 각 배열 객체는 and relationship_sys_id 속성을 포함하는 HashMap입니다predecessor_sys_id.
| 이름 | 유형 | 설명 |
|---|---|---|
| 없음 |
| 유형 | 설명 |
|---|---|
| 객체 배열 | predecessor_sys_id 및 relationship_sys_id의 두 가지 내부 속성을 포함하는 HashMap 목록입니다. |
타임라인스팬 - getSpanColor()
이 범위를 표시하기 위해 지정된 색의 문자열 이름을 반환합니다.
| 이름 | 유형 | 설명 |
|---|---|---|
| 없음 |
| 유형 | 설명 |
|---|---|
| 문자열 | 요소의 배경색으로 사용할 HTML 색 이름입니다. |
타임라인스팬 - getSpanText()
시간 요소 옆에 표시할 텍스트를 지정하는 문자열을 반환합니다.
glideTimeline.showTimelineText(true)를 통해 타임라인 텍스트를 활성화한 경우에만 표시됩니다.| 이름 | 유형 | 설명 |
|---|---|---|
| 없음 |
| 유형 | 설명 |
|---|---|
| 문자열 | 요소 옆에 표시되는 텍스트입니다. |
TimelineSpan - getStartTimeMs()
현재 TimelineSpan 개체의 시작 시간(밀리초)을 반환합니다.
| 이름 | 유형 | 설명 |
|---|---|---|
| 없음 |
| 유형 | 설명 |
|---|---|
| 번호 | 요소의 시작 시간(밀리초)입니다. |
타임라인스팬 - getSysId()
현재 객체의 시스템 ID를 반환합니다.
이 메서드는 동적으로 생성된 GUID를 가져오기 위해 특정 시스템 ID 없이 현재 개체 인스턴스를 만들 때 시스템 ID를 반환하는 데 유용합니다.
| 이름 | 유형 | 설명 |
|---|---|---|
| 없음 |
| 유형 | 설명 |
|---|---|
| 문자열 | 현재 요소의 고유 시스템 ID입니다. |
타임라인스팬 - getTable()
시스템 ID가 참조되는 테이블의 이름을 반환합니다.
| 이름 | 유형 | 설명 |
|---|---|---|
| 없음 |
| 유형 | 설명 |
|---|---|
| 문자열 | 테이블 이름입니다. |
TimelineSpan - getTooltip()
TimelineSpan 요소를 가리킬 때 도구 설명에 표시할 text/html을 반환합니다.
| 이름 | 유형 | 설명 |
|---|---|---|
| 없음 |
| 유형 | 설명 |
|---|---|
| 문자열 | 도구 설명 텍스트입니다. |
TimelineSpan - setAllowXDragLeft(Boolean bFlag)
요소의 시작 날짜를 왼쪽 또는 오른쪽으로 끌어서 작업 기간을 조정할 수 있는지 여부를 결정하는 플래그를 설정합니다.
이 동작의 효과는 해당 이벤트를 처리하는 스크립트 포함에 의해 제어됩니다. 이 속성의 기본값은 false입니다.
| 이름 | 유형 | 설명 |
|---|---|---|
| b플래그 | 부울 | 요소의 시작 날짜를 조정할 수 있도록 하려면 예입니다. 그렇지 않으면 false 입니다. |
| 유형 | 설명 |
|---|---|
| void |
TimelineSpan - setAllowXDragRight(Boolean bFlag)
요소의 종료 날짜를 왼쪽이나 오른쪽으로 끌어서 작업 기간을 조정할 수 있는지 여부를 결정하는 플래그를 설정합니다.
이 동작의 효과는 해당 이벤트를 처리하는 스크립트 포함에 의해 제어됩니다. 이 속성의 기본값은 false입니다.
| 이름 | 유형 | 설명 |
|---|---|---|
| b플래그 | 부울 | 요소의 종료 날짜를 조정할 수 있도록 하려면 예입니다. 그렇지 않으면 false 입니다. |
| 유형 | 설명 |
|---|---|
| void |
TimelineSpan - setAllowXMove(Boolean bFlag )
요소를 다른 시간에 시작하도록 이동할 수 있는지 여부를 결정하는 플래그를 설정합니다.
이 동작의 효과는 해당 이벤트를 처리하는 스크립트 포함에 의해 제어됩니다. 이 속성의 기본값은 false입니다.
| 이름 | 유형 | 설명 |
|---|---|---|
| b플래그 | 부울 | 요소를 수평으로 이동할 수 있도록 하려면 True입니다. 그렇지 않으면 false 입니다. |
| 유형 | 설명 |
|---|---|
| void |
TimelineSpan - setAllowYMove(Boolean bFlag )
요소를 타임라인에서 세로로 끌 수 있는지 여부를 결정하는 플래그를 설정합니다.
이 동작의 효과는 해당 이벤트를 처리하는 스크립트 포함에 의해 제어됩니다. 이 속성의 기본값은 false입니다.
| 이름 | 유형 | 설명 |
|---|---|---|
| b플래그 | 부울 | 요소를 세로로 이동할 수 있도록 하려면 True입니다. 그렇지 않으면 false 입니다. |
| 유형 | 설명 |
|---|---|
| void |
TimelineSpan - setAllowYMovePredecessor(부울 bFlag)
타임라인에서 대화형으로 이 요소에서 파선 관계 라인을 그릴 수 있는지 여부를 결정하는 플래그를 설정합니다.
이 동작의 효과는 해당 이벤트를 처리하는 스크립트 포함에 의해 제어됩니다. 이 속성의 기본값은 false입니다.
| 이름 | 유형 | 설명 |
|---|---|---|
| b플래그 | 부울 | 이 요소에서 관계선을 그릴 수 있도록 하려면 예입니다. 그렇지 않으면 false 입니다. |
| 유형 | 설명 |
|---|---|
| void |
TimelineSpan - setInnerSegmentClass(String styleClass)
내부 세그먼트가 있는 경우 스타일을 지정하는 데 사용할 클래스의 이름을 지정합니다.
기본값은 녹색입니다.
| 이름 | 유형 | 설명 |
|---|---|---|
| style클래스 | 문자열 | 녹색, 파란색 또는 은색 값 중 하나입니다. |
| 유형 | 설명 |
|---|---|
| void |
TimelineSpan - setInnerSegmentTimeSpan(startTimeMs, endTimeMs)
지정된 범위로 정의된 현재 시간 범위 내에 표시할 내부 세그먼트를 만듭니다.
| 이름 | 유형 | 설명 |
|---|---|---|
| startTimeMs | 번호 | 시작 시간(밀리초)입니다. |
| endTimeMs | 번호 | 종료 시간(밀리초)입니다. |
| 유형 | 설명 |
|---|---|
| void |
TimelineSpan - setPointIconClass(String iconClassName)
현재 인스턴스에 지속 시간이 0인 경우 타임라인에 현재 요소를 표시하는 데 사용할 아이콘 클래스를 설정합니다.
| 이름 | 유형 | 설명 |
|---|---|---|
| iconClassName | 문자열 | 다음 값 중 하나를 지정하는 문자열입니다.
|
| 유형 | 설명 |
|---|---|
| void |
TimelineSpan - setSpanColor(strColor 문자열)
이 범위를 표시할 색을 설정합니다.
| 이름 | 유형 | 설명 |
|---|---|---|
| 스트컬러 | 문자열 | 이 범위의 색에 대한 HTML 색 이름입니다. |
| 유형 | 설명 |
|---|---|
| void |
TimelineSpan - setSpanText(strSpanText문자열)
시간 요소 옆에 표시할 텍스트를 설정합니다.
glideTimeline.showTimelineText(true)를 통해 타임라인 텍스트를 활성화한 경우에만 표시됩니다.| 이름 | 유형 | 설명 |
|---|---|---|
| strSpan텍스트 | 문자열 | 시간 요소 옆에 표시할 텍스트입니다. |
| 유형 | 설명 |
|---|---|
| void |
TimelineSpan - setTimeSpan(Number nStartTime, Number nEndTimeMs)
현재 범위의 시작 및 종료 날짜를 설정합니다.
| 이름 | 유형 | 설명 |
|---|---|---|
| 엔스타트타임 | 번호 | 시작 시간(밀리초)입니다. |
| nEndTimeMs | 번호 | 종료 시간(밀리초)입니다. |
| 유형 | 설명 |
|---|---|
| void |
TimelineSpan - setTimeSpan(strStartTime 문자열, strEndTimeMs) 문자열
현재 범위의 시작 및 종료 시간을 설정합니다.
| 이름 | 유형 | 설명 |
|---|---|---|
| 스트스타트타임 | 문자열 | 시작 시간(밀리초)입니다. |
| strEndTimeMs | 문자열 | 종료 시간(밀리초)입니다. |
| 유형 | 설명 |
|---|---|
| void |
TimelineSpan - setTooltip(String strTooltipText)
TimelinSpan 요소를 마우스로 가리킬 때 도구 설명에 표시할 텍스트를 설정합니다.
| 이름 | 유형 | 설명 |
|---|---|---|
| strTooltipText | 문자열 | 도구 설명에 표시할 텍스트입니다. |
| 유형 | 설명 |
|---|---|
| void |